2011 SDG to PHP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2011

During 2011, the SDG to PHP ex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on January 24, valuing the pair at 17.8225.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on April 6, dropping to 15.3922.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 2.4303 PHP.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 17.6702 to the December average rate of 16.3076, the exchange rate registered a net change of -7.71% (reflecting a weakening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2011 high of 17.8225 was down 15.89% compared to the 2010 peak of 21.1894,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.

Monthly Breakdown

Statistical summary for each calendar month.

Month High Low Average
January 17.8225 17.4366 17.6702
February 17.5549 16.1702 16.7890
March 16.0860 15.4587 15.6757
April 16.2082 15.3922 15.9971
May 16.2891 15.9316 16.1439
June 16.3784 16.1362 16.2318
July 16.1467 15.7385 15.9743
August 15.9319 15.6727 15.8734
September 16.4411 15.7481 16.1032
October 16.4514 15.9427 16.2124
November 16.4806 15.9670 16.2102
December 16.5082 16.1312 16.3076
